Pivot Expression.Error

Hello all,

 

I am trying to pivot two columns, using the do not aggregate value funtion.


However, I get back the following error:

 

Expression.Error: We cannot apply operator < to types Record and Record.
Details:
Operator=&lt;
Left=Record
Right=Record

 

 

Can someone please advice on how fix this issue?

@Anonymous,

 

Tables with nested columns are not supported. You'll need to expand a column of records into columns first.
